Behati Prinsloo shows off incredible postbaby body in plunging LBD as she makes first red carpet appearance since giving birth at the AMAs

Behati Prinsloo made her first red carpet appearance since welcoming daughter Dusty Rose with husband Adam Levine at the 2016 American Music Awards.

Showing off her post-baby body, the 27-year-old Victoria's Secret Angel looked sensational in a plunging LBD and matching strappy stilettos as she arrived at the 44th annual ceremony held at Microsoft Theater in Los Angeles. 

The stunning new mom walked the red carpet solo as her musician hubby is set to perform with Maroon 5 featuring Kendrick Lamar during Sunday's show. 

Red carpet debut! Behati Prinsloo made her first official appearance at the 2016 American Music Awards in Los Angeles on Sunday since welcoming daughter Dusty Rose on September 21 with husband Adam Levine

Behati took the plunge in a sexy black mini-dress which featured a daring neckline showing off her ample cleavage. 

The mother-of-one, who gave birth just two months ago, on on September 21, showed off her trim waistline as the silk frock featured a corset for a bodice. 

The silhouette hugged her every curve minus some extra fabric which draped in front of her tummy.

The five-foot-11 stunner made a leggy display as the LBD's asymmetrical hemline stopped super high on her lean thigh.

2016 AMERICAN MUSIC AWARDS WINNERS

ARTIST OF THE YEAR

Adele

Beyonce

Justin Bieber

Drake 

Selena Gomez

Ariana Grande - WINNER

Rihanna

Twenty One Pilots

Carrie Underwood

The Weeknd

NEW ARTIST OF THE YEAR UN-LEASHED BY T-MOBILE

Alessia Cara

The Chainsmokers

DNCE

Shawn Mendes

ZAYN - WINNER

COLLABORATION OF THE YEAR

The Chainsmokers Featuring Daya "Don't Let Me Down"

Drake Featuring Wizkid & Kyla "One Dance"

Fifth Harmony Featuring Ty Dolla $ign "Work From Home" - WINNER

Rihanna Featuring Drake "Work"

Meghan Trainor Featuring John Legend "Like I'm Gonna Lose You"

TOUR OF THE YEAR

Beyonce - WINNER

Madonna

Bruce Springsteen & the E Street Band

VIDEO OF THE YEAR

Justin Bieber "Sorry" - WINNER

Desiigner "Panda"

Rihanna Featuring Drake "Work"

FAVORITE MALE ARTIST - POP/ROCK

Justin Bieber - WINNER

Drake

The Weeknd

FAVORITE FEMALE ARTIST - POP/ROCK

Adele

Selena Gomez - WINNER

Rihanna

FAVORITE DUO OR GROUP - POP/ROCK

The Chainsmokers

DNCE

Twenty One Pilots - WINNER

FAVORITE ALBUM - POP/ROCK

Adele "25"

Justin Bieber "Purpose" - WINNER

Drake "Views"

FAVORITE SONG - POP/ROCK

Adele "Hello"

Justin Bieber "Love Yourself" - WINNER

Drake Featuring Wizkid & Kyla "One Dance"

FAVORITE MALE ARTIST - COUNTRY

Luke Bryan

Thomas Rhett

Blake Shelton - WINNER

FAVORITE FEMALE ARTIST - COUNTRY

Kelsea Ballerini

Cam

Carrie Underwood - WINNER

FAVORITE DUO OR GROUP - COUNTRY

Florida Georgia Line - WINNER

Old Dominion

Zac Brown Band 

FAVORITE ALBUM - COUNTRY

Luke Bryan "Kill The Lights"

Chris Stapleton "Traveller"

Carrie Underwood "Storyteller" - WINNER

FAVORITE SONG - COUNTRY

Florida Georgia Line "H.O.L.Y"

Tim McGraw "Humble And Kind" - WINNER

Thomas Rhett "Die A Happy Man"

FAVORITE ARTIST - RAP/HIP HOP

Drake - WINNER

Fetty Wap

Future

FAVORITE ALBUM - RAP/HIP HOP

Drake "Views" - WINNER

Drake & Future "What A Time To Be Alive"

Fetty Wap "Fetty Wap"

FAVORITE SONG - RAP/HIP HOP

Desiigner "Prada"

Drake "Hotline Bling" - WINNER

Fetty Wap "679"

FAVORITE MALE ARTIST - SOUL/R&B

Chris Brown - WINNER

Bryson Tiller

The Weeknd

FAVORITE FEMALE ARTIST - SOUL/R&B

Beyonce

Janet Jackson

Rihanna - WINNER

FAVORITE ALBUM - SOUL/R&B

Beyonce "Lemonade"

Rihanna "Anti" - WINNER

Bryson Tiller "TRAPSOUL"

FAVORITE SONG - SOUL/R&B

Drake Featuring Wizkid & Kyla "One Dance"

Rihanna Featuring Drake "Work" - WINNER

Bryson Tiller "Don't"

FAVORITE ARTIST - ALTERNATIVE ROCK

Coldplay

Twenty One Pilots - WINNER

X Ambassadors

FAVORITE ARTIST - ADULT CONTEMPORARY

Adele - WINNER

Rachel Platten

Meghan Trainor

FAVORITE ARTIST - LATIN

J Balvin

Enrique Iglesias - WINNER

Nicky Jam

FAVORITE ARTIST - CONTEMPORARY INSPIRATIONAL

Lauren Daigle

Hillsong UNITED - WINNER

Chris Tomlin

FAVORITE ARTIST - ELECTRONIC DANCE MUSIC (EDM)

The Chainsmokers - WINNER

Calvin Harris

Major Lazer

TOP SOUNDTRACK

Purple Rain - WINNER

Star Wars: The Force Awakens

Suicide Squad: The Album
